What is informative essay example?

An informative essay educates your reader on a topic. They can have one of several functions: to define a term, compare and contrast something, analyze data, or provide a how-to. They do not, however, present an opinion or try to persuade your reader. Examples are; animals, a country, a sport or club, cooking.

How do you start an informative essay?

The introduction to your informative essay should be something that will grab your reader’s attention. Include an essay hook, a thesis statement, and a transition sentence (usually the same sentence) to make sure everything moves smoothly.

How many paragraphs are in an informative essay?

Like most types of essays, the informative essay will consist of the basic format of four to five paragraphs. These five paragraphs will include the introduction, two to three supporting paragraphs, and a conclusion.

What are the three main parts of an informative essay?

Informative essays outline are generally divided into three main parts: the introduction, body, and conclusion. The introduction and conclusion parts will generally each be one paragraph long. However, the body section will include several paragraphs.

What is the first step in writing an informative essay?

The first step to writing an informative essay is to choose a topic that applies to the given prompt. Do this by brainstorming, which means to produce thoughts or ideas in a spontaneous matter. Write down any ideas that come into your head that both interest you and relate to the prompt.

How do you structure an essay?

The structure of an essay is divided into an introduction that presents your topic and thesis statement, a body containing your in-depth analysis and arguments, and a conclusion wrapping up your ideas.
